Platform Availability
Multiplayer games are available on a multitude of platforms, ensuring that everyone can join in on the fun. Here’s a breakdown of where you can find these games:
- PC: Available through platforms like Steam, Epic Games Store, and GOG.
- Consoles: Access games via PlayStation Store, Xbox Store, and Nintendo eShop.
- Mobile: Download from Google Play and Apple App Store for on-the-go gaming.
System Requirements
Before diving into multiplayer gaming, it’s crucial to ensure your device meets the necessary system requirements. While these can vary by game, here’s a general guideline:
- For PC: At least 8GB RAM, dedicated graphics card with a minimum of 4GB VRAM, and a high-speed internet connection.
- For Consoles: Ensure the latest firmware updates are installed for optimal performance.
- For Mobile: Devices should be running the latest OS version for compatibility.
How to Download
Getting started with your favorite multiplayer game is easy. Follow these steps to download and install games from official platforms:
For PC Users
- Visit the official store such as Steam or Epic Games Store.
- Create an account or log in if you already have one.
- Search for your desired game, whether it's the latest title or classic hits.
- Click on the download option and follow the prompts to install the game.
For Console Users
- Power on your console and navigate to the respective store (PlayStation Store or Xbox Store).
- Search for the game you wish to download.
- Purchase or download the game if it’s free to play.
- The game will start downloading automatically, and you can check the download progress in the library.
For Mobile Users
- Open the Google Play Store or Apple App Store.
- Type the name of the multiplayer game in the search bar.
- Tap on the game’s icon and select download or install.
- Once installed, launch the game and start playing!
